S E N A T E   R E S O L U T I O N
CELEBRATING MAY 21, 2024, AS "KOREA DAY" IN THE STATE OF RHODE ISLAND

Introduced By: Senators Ujifusa, Gu, Raptakis, F. Lombardi, Felag, Ciccone, E Morgan, Britto, Mack, and Cano

Date Introduced: May 21, 2024

     WHEREAS, The cornerstone of Rhode Island's founding principles is acceptance and
equality for the numerous beliefs and various cultures that make our State and this Country so
great, and thus proud to be the home of numerous ethnic communities; and
     WHEREAS, Rhode Island's Korean American community imparts a rich history and
vitality through their presence. Our State's identity and strength is reflected in the traditions and
observances celebrated by its various cultures and populations; and
     WHEREAS, Korea emerged from the ashes of the Korean War in 1950 to become a
nation that has achieved and succeeded as a leader in democracy and economic development in
Asia; and
     WHEREAS, In addition, South Korea has risen as a cultural and inspiring powerhouse
globally with the widespread diffusion of Hallyu and the emergence of KPOP music, tourism and
worldwide love of Korean cuisine as part of the Korean Wave; and
     WHEREAS, The sacrifices and dedication of Korean War veterans from the State of
Rhode Island contributed to the establishment of the enduring Republic of Korea-United States
(ROK-US) alliance in 1953, rooted in common values of freedom and democracy and evolving
into a Global Comprehensive Strategic Alliance; and
     WHEREAS, Under the tenure of Kim Jae-hui, the Consul General of the Republic of
Korea in Boston, there has been a greater mutual understanding, outreach, and cooperation
between Korea and Rhode Island that has matured and been strengthened in the Ocean State; and
     WHEREAS, Economically, South Korea is an important trade partner for Rhode Island
with exports of $41 million (USO), making it one of the top fifteen exporters for the State; and
     WHEREAS, In addition, the Korean American Association of Rhode Island (KAARI)
was founded in 1975, with the desire to celebrate and share Korean culture with Rhode Island.
The organization is dedicated to promoting friendship, welfare, and education among its
members, and contributes to beneficial cultural exchanges and international goodwill between
Koreans and Americans in our State; and
     WHEREAS, The Korean community in Rhode Island is an essential element in our
State's journey towards understanding, mutual respect, and common purpose for all people, and is
a vital component in our State's economic health; now, therefore be it
     RESOLVED, That this Senate of the State of Rhode Island hereby celebrates May 21,
2024, as "Korea Day" in the State of Rhode Island. We furthermore extend our deepest respect
and appreciation to the Rhode Island Korean community for all that it has contributed to the rich
diversity of our State and New England as a whole; and be it further
     RESOLVED, That the Secretary of State be and hereby is authorized and directed to
transmit duly certified copies of this resolution to the Korean American Association of Rhode
Island and to Kim Jae-hui, Consul General of the Republic of Korea in Boston.
